M.Satyanarayana Murthy, J.
1. The sole accused in Sessions Case No.218 of 2009 on the file of the Special Sessions Judge for Trial of S.Cs & S.Ts Cases-cum-Additional Sessions Judge, Anantapur, (hereinafter will be referred as trial Court for convenience), preferred this appeal under Section 374 (2) of Cr.P.C, questioning the legality of the conviction and sentence recorded by the trial Court finding him guilty for the offence under Section 302 of IPC.
2. It is the gruesome murder of the wife allegedly by the husband on 15.04.2008 on the hillock of Palavai village of Kalyandurg Mandal, Anantapur, at about 11.00 a.m. suspecting her fidelity for the last many years, though they lead happy marital life for three years. One Nagaraju, on coming to know about the incident, telephoned to PW.1 about committing murder of their daughter Lalitha @ Lalithamma. On that, PWs.1 and 2 came to the village and PW.1 lodged a report marked as Ex.P1 with the police and, on the strength of the same, a case in Crime No.49 of 2008 was registered for the offence punishable under Section 302 of IPC and Ex.P15 First Information Report was issued.
